Overproduction of polyketide precursors to enhance Spinosad production. (A) Biosynthetic pathway for polyketide precursors. AcsA: acetyl-CoA synthetase. PCC: propionyl-CoA carboxylase. ACC: acetyl-CoA carboxylase. (B) Spinosad production in engineered strains. Each sample was performed in triplicate with error bars representing mean ± SD. (C) Fold change in acyl-CoAs in S. albus J1074, ADE, and ADE-AP. All strains were fermented for 3 days, the concentration of all acyl-CoAs was calculated according to the content per gram of cell dry weight (μg/g cdw). The concentration of S. albus J1074 was defined as “1”, and the concentration of ADE and ADE-AP was expressed as their fold change of S. albus J1074. Each sample was performed in triplicate, and the average value was used to calculate the fold change. (D) Spinosad production in ADE and ADE-AP following three-day fermentation. The samples are from the same batch of samples shown in panel C. Each sample was performed in triplicate with the error bars indicating mean ± SD.
